Mango trees thrive in tropical climates, but with the right care, they can flourish in Nevada’s desert environment. The key factors include temperature, sunlight, and soil type. Understanding these elements is essential for successful cultivation.
Temperature: Mango trees prefer temperatures between 70°F and 100°F. They can tolerate brief drops to 30°F but may suffer damage.
Sunlight: Full sunlight is crucial. Aim for at least 8 hours of direct sunlight daily.
Soil: Well-draining soil is essential. Sandy loam with a pH of 5.5 to 7.5 is ideal.

Consider these methods for optimal watering:
Drip Irrigation: This method delivers water directly to the root zone, minimizing evaporation and runoff.
Soaker Hoses: These hoses allow water to seep slowly into the soil, providing consistent moisture.
Sprinkler Systems: Use with caution as they can lead to excess moisture on leaves, promoting fungal diseases.
| Irrigation Method | Pros | Cons |
|---|---|---|
| Drip Irrigation | Efficient water use | Initial setup cost |
| Soaker Hoses | Easy to install | Limited coverage |
| Sprinkler Systems | Covers large areas | Can promote diseases |

Follow this schedule for optimal results:
Spring: Apply a slow-release fertilizer as new growth begins.
Summer: Use a liquid fertilizer every 4-6 weeks during the growing season.
Fall: Apply a low-nitrogen fertilizer to prepare the tree for dormancy.
| Fertilizer Type | Application Timing | Notes |
|---|---|---|
| Slow-release | Spring | Supports new growth |
| Liquid | Summer | Boosts fruit production |
| Low-nitrogen | Fall | Prepares for dormancy |

Mango Harvest Timing and Techniques
Understanding the timing and techniques for harvesting mangoes is crucial for maximizing yield and ensuring fruit quality, especially in Nevada’s unique desert climate. This section delves into the optimal harvest periods and effective methods tailored to the challenges of growing mango trees in arid conditions, providing practical insights for successful cultivation.
Follow these guidelines for the best results:
Color Change: Harvest when the fruit turns from green to a yellowish hue.
Firmness: Gently squeeze the fruit; it should yield slightly to pressure.
Aroma: A ripe mango emits a sweet aroma near the stem.
Avoid harvesting too early to prevent sour taste and poor texture.
